Claim 1 clm-1ed7dfc9bd92bc3d quantitative
Chugach Electric integrates the 11-turbine, 17.6MW Fire Island wind farm (running since 2012, about 3% of retail load) into Anchorage's Railbelt grid

Claim 2 clm-337bceed308ebd4d quantitative
Since October 2024 it also stabilizes that grid with a 40MW/80MWh Tesla Megapack battery system, co-owned with Matanuska Electric ($65M total), that replaces spinning-reserve gas generators as backup

Claim 3 clm-4538c81bc6cc0cfb quantitative
Chugach projects the battery system will cut Railbelt-area natural gas consumption by about 5% a year by holding spinning reserve instead of idling gas turbines for it

What the mapping says
The commissioning release states the expected reduction in natural gas consumption and the mechanism — holding reserve in the battery rather than in part-loaded turbines.
Caveat
A projection by the utility that bought the system; no measured saving has been published since commissioning.
